dan200.turtle.api.TurtleUpgradeType
public enum TurtleUpgradeType
An enum representing the two different types of upgrades that an ITurtleUpgrade implementation can add to a turtle.
ITurtleUpgrade| Enum Constant Summary | |
|---|---|
Peripheral
A peripheral adds a special peripheral which is attached to the side of the turtle, and can be interacted with the peripheral API (Such as the modem on Wireless Turtles). |
|
Tool
A tool is rendered as an item on the side of the turtle, and responds to the turtle.dig() and turtle.attack() methods (Such as pickaxe or sword on Mining and Melee turtles). |
